OEIS A000101: Record Prime Gaps

About this episode

We dive into A000101, the OEIS sequence that marks the endpoints of record-breaking prime gaps. Learn what a prime gap is, how the record gaps line up with A002386 on the lower end, and why Ramanujan primes appear as interesting exceptions. We’ll explore the massive computational feats behind gaps that span millions or billions of integers, the contributions of researchers like Tomas Oliveira e Silva and Thomas Nicely, and how these gaps relate to big puzzles like the twin prime conjecture. The entry also provides a formula linking A000101 to related sequences and code in Mathematica and PARI/GP to generate terms, plus graphs and cross-references that deepen our understanding of prime distribution.
